CVE-2025-15543

Read-only system file disclosure via USB symlinks

Published Jan 29, 2026 · Updated Jan 29, 2026

Improper link resolution in the USB HTTP path of TP-Link VX800v v1.0 allows physically proximate attackers to read system files. The web module resolves crafted symbolic links on USB storage to targets in the root filesystem and returns the target files over HTTP. Physical access to insert the device is required, and the demonstrated consequence is read-only disclosure without file modification or service interruption.
